Overview of Texas Instruments LM1117DTX-2.5
The LM1117DTX-2.5 is a linear voltage regulator integrated circuit from Texas Instruments, designed to offer a precise, stable voltage supply for a variety of electronic devices and systems. This particular model provides a fixed output voltage of 2.5V, which is essential for applications requiring a regulated power source to maintain optimal performance.
Key Features
- Output Voltage: The LM1117DTX-2.5 ensures a steady 2.5V output, which is crucial for sensitive electronics that require a constant voltage level for proper operation.
- Current Capability: It can deliver up to 800mA of output current, making it suitable for powering small to medium-sized devices.
- Low Dropout: With a low dropout voltage, this regulator performs efficiently even when the input voltage is close to the output voltage, reducing power loss and improving system efficiency.
- Thermal Protection: The device includes built-in thermal shutdown to protect against excessive temperatures that could potentially damage the regulator or the connected components.
- Current Limiting: A current limiting feature is integrated to prevent damage from overcurrent conditions, ensuring the longevity of both the regulator and the device it powers.
- Package: The LM1117DTX-2.5 comes in a TO-252 package which is compact and suitable for surface-mount technology, allowing for efficient use of PCB space.
